Step-by-step explanation:

One word problem of velocity vectors with its solution:

A boat attempts to travel straight across a river at a speed of 3.8 m/s. The river current flows at a speed of 6.1 m/s to the right. To find the total velocity and direction of the boat, we need to consider both the boat's speed and the river current's speed. We can represent each meter per second of velocity as one centimeter of vector length in our drawing. By using vector addition, we can calculate the total velocity of the boat.
